Transaction 2faab5232f7d6ce14ed2cccd07aba2f9fdaec9bbf8cc76ee4148a16416edc5ac
1 Input
1 Output
-
2faab5232f7d6ce14ed2cccd07aba2f9fdaec9bbf8cc76ee4148a16416edc5ac:0
- value
- 1439252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ff604c952d426196ace456e36ab3b8c3f6b1d6e OP_EQUAL
- address
- 34c1bAmZ8zV66bbQSPpzSAMDWFmpc5ta8Z